A Glimpse into the Beauty of Ocellated Turkey Eggs
The eggs of the ocellated turkey are a true marvel of nature. These vibrant orbs boast a distinct pattern of geometric brown and white spots. This mesmerizing arrangement makes each egg a testament to nature's beauty. They are a rare sight and a fascinating reminder of the wild world's treasures. Differing from their domesticated cousins, ocella